IMDB Synopsis
Unfulfilled and facing financial ruin, actor Nick Cage accepts a $1 million offer to attend a wealthy fan’s birthday party. Things take a wildly unexpected turn when a CIA operative recruits Cage for an unusual mission. Taking on the role of a lifetime, he soon finds himself channeling his most iconic and beloved characters to save himself and his loved ones.

Nicholas Cage is one of the most divisive people on planet Earth. There are some who will say he is a genius who has made a list of incredible movies, and holds an Oscar for Best Actor (yes you read that right). Others will say he is a madman who has been making Direct to Video movies for the last 15 years. Regardless, of which side you are on, everyone has a strong opinion about this man. Which is why this new movie would only work being about him and him alone.
THE UNBEARABLE WEIGHT OF MASSIVE TALENT is a movie that sounds like a joke when you read the description. Nic Cage, playing Nic Cage is hired for a birthday party for 1 million dollars, yet when he gets there he is sucked in a international drug sting. Sounds insane right? However, I am here to tell you this is one of the funniest movies I have seen in a long time. And again the reason for that is Cage’s willingness to be self aware about his career and image and utilize that self awareness and create humor from it.

The bulk of the story though Cage spends with Pedro Pascal’s Javi and the two of them create magic together with their chemistry. Once the movie drifts to full blown action comedy the two of them turn into a Riggs/Murtaugh, Chan/Tucker type of duo. Even if you have not dove deep into the Cage filmography it will be funny but in those scenes if you are familiar with Cage’s work, there is so many payoffs and so many moments that will make you smile.
As far as the technical aspects of the movie, the Filming and the Scoring was done by two people I had never heard of. However, both though were still very well done, the filming was engaging in particular with the way they were able to put Cage in the positions to utilize his past characters. And the score was solid and didn’t really take me out of any scenes, even if it did not necessarily blow me away.
Stock Watch

Stock Up – Nicholas Cage
Obviously the guy is a legend, but clearly he has been down in the industry which is why this movie was made. But his performance is so good I could see him getting another wave of cool roles, because he can really just do anything.

Stock Neutral – Pedro Pascal
Pedro Pascal is at the top right now and can basically do anything he wants. He is the star of the biggest show in the world, was just in a huge DC movie and now is in this hilarious comedy. Give him a script and this guy is gonna make lemonade.

This movie is just an absolute blast at the theater. I will say though the more you enjoy the work of Nicolas Cage, the more this movie will do for you. But, either way I think most people can look at this and just have fun.
